With the accelerated development of Shanxi's export - oriented economy, more and more enterprises are turning their attention to overseas markets. However, the three major obstacles of international logistics, tariff policies, and qualification certification have deterred many entrepreneurs.
After visiting more than a dozen local enterprises in Shanxi, we found the following common misunderstandings:
- "Finding a freight forwarder can handle everything": In fact, special goods such as medical devices require import licenses, and food products need to be pre - filed. These all require professional teams to operate;
- "The cheaper the tariff, the better": Ms. Li from Taiyuan once paid 23% more in tariffs because she chose a non - agreement tax rate. In fact, free trade agreements such as those between China and South Korea, and China and ASEAN can enjoy preferential treatment;
- "The cost, insurance and freight (CIF) price is the most cost - effective": When the international transportation adopts the CIF clause, the marine insurance often has insufficient coverage. Last year, an enterprise bore a loss of 700,000 yuan due to damaged goods.
Take the Italian wine import project handled by Zhongshitong as an example. The keys to success lie in three aspects:
- Pre - classification: Submit the pre - confirmation of the commodity code to the customs 6 months in advance to avoid late - declaration fees due to classification disputes after the goods arrive at the port;
- Dynamic tracking: Through the blockchain traceability system, monitor the whole - process temperature control from the Port of Hamburg to Taiyuan Comprehensive Bonded Zone in real - time;
- Tax planning: Utilize the RCEP origin accumulation rule, place part of the bottling process in Vietnam, and finally reduce the tariff to 5.8%.
In 2023, two significant changes occurred in the Shanxi import agency market: First, the proportion of the cross - border e - commerce B2B model increased to 37%, and second, the demand for "door - to - door" services increased by 200%. It is worth noting that:
- The "pre - inspection" channel opened in Taiyuan Wusu Comprehensive Bonded Zone can reduce the customs clearance time to 6 hours;
- Overseas exhibitions such as the German Industrial Exhibition have started to provide a one - stop solution for product selection - logistics - customs clearance;
- Some agencies have launched a "risk - sharing" model, charging a floating service fee based on the import volume.
We suggest choosing according to the annual import volume:
- Trial period (< 500,000 yuan): Give priority to service providers that handle documents on behalf of others and settle accounts per ticket;
- Growth period (500,000 - 3,000,000 yuan): It is recommended to sign an annual framework agreement to enjoy volume discounts;
- Stable period (> 3,000,000 yuan): You can consider jointly establishing an overseas procurement center to directly connect with source suppliers.
